Climate Control for Year-Round Enjoyment

While enjoying your pool is often limited by seasonal changes, a pool enclosure allows you to swim comfortably year-round.

With the right enclosure, you can maintain a stable temperature, shielding yourself from chilly winds and sudden weather shifts. This means fewer surprises when you decide to take a dip. By trapping heat from the sun during the day, your pool remains inviting, even in cooler months.

Additionally, an enclosure helps prevent evaporation, keeping your water levels steady and reducing the need for constant refills. You'll also notice that the air inside feels more pleasant, making it an ideal space for relaxation and recreation.

Enjoying your pool becomes a possibility no matter the season, enhancing your outdoor experience significantly.

Stylish Design Options

When considering a pool enclosure, you'll discover a variety of stylish design options that not only enhance the aesthetic appeal of your outdoor space but also maintain your privacy.

Choosing the right enclosure can make your pool area a true oasis. Here are three popular design options:

  1. Screen Enclosures: These provide unobstructed views while keeping insects out, blending seamlessly with nature.
  2. Glass Enclosures: Offering a modern touch, glass enclosures maximize light and visibility while providing excellent privacy.
  3. Wooden or Composite Fencing: These options add a rustic charm and create a natural barrier, ensuring you enjoy your pool in peace.

With these stylish options, you can easily elevate your pool area while enjoying the privacy you desire.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Does a Pool Enclosure Affect My Homeowner's Insurance Policy?

A pool enclosure might lower your homeowner's insurance premium by reducing liability risks. However, it's essential to inform your insurer about the enclosure, as coverage details can vary based on your specific policy and location.

Can I Install a Pool Enclosure Myself?

Yes, you can install a pool enclosure yourself, but it requires careful planning and the right tools. Make sure to check local regulations and guidelines to ensure your installation meets safety standards and building codes.

What Materials Are Pool Enclosures Typically Made From?

Pool enclosures are typically made from materials like aluminum framing, tempered glass, or sturdy screen mesh. You'll find these materials provide durability, protection from pests, and enhance the overall look of your outdoor space.
